Send your completed application and we'll hit you back!Summary: Oversees daily operations of the entire restaurant, ensuring smooth function and optimal customer satisfaction. Their responsibilities include managing staff, scheduling, inventory management, budgeting, and maintaining high standards of food quality, service, and cleanliness. They also handle customer complaints, implement marketing strategies to attract more patrons, and collaborate with the kitchen and front-of-house teams to enhance efficiency and profitability.
